What Is An Automatic Pour-Over Coffee Maker?

An automatic pour-over coffee maker is a machine that brews fresh coffee with a simple press of a button automatically. These machines make the richest and most flavourful coffee without requiring manual brewing. As opposed to a manual pour-over coffee machine, an automatic pour-over coffee maker heats water and prepares great pour-over coffee by mixing the heated water with ground coffee beans, all automatically.

How Does An Automatic Pour-Over Coffee Maker Work?

The pour-over coffee maker is indeed a miraculous gift of technology, and it is no surprise if you are curious about how it works. The process is very simple, but the task is, no doubt, exhausting if it has to be done manually. The machine heats the water and pours it over coffee grounds. An accurate water temperature ensures that the flavor from the grounds blooms to its best taste.

Brewing in the automatic pour-over coffee maker is quite different from a standard brew machine. Firstly, the way the water is poured is much more effective in extracting the flavor of the coffee grounds. Water is poured such that it is evenly distributed over the beans rather than being dripped at the center. Secondly, the water is preheated before it is poured over the coffee grounds.

If you haven’t had pour-over coffee ever before, here is what it means. Pour-over coffee, as the name suggests, is when boiling water is ‘poured over’ a coffee filter filled with coffee grounds. 2. Temperature Control

If you genuinely are a coffee lover, you must know the importance of water temperature control in making the best and most flavorful cup of coffee. The ideal temperature for pour-over coffee is 195-205 degrees Fahrenheit. When looking for an automatic pour-over coffee machine, look for one that not only heats but also maintains the temperature during the brewing.

3. Hot Plate or Thermal Carafe

The hot plate does look like a fabulous idea, but a close inspection would reveal that it actually does not result in a good-tasting mug of coffee. Since the heating process continues even after the brewing is over, the continuous ‘cooking’ of coffee results in a poor taste.

An alternative and more effective healing process involve a thermal carafe that maintains heat. When looking at the heating process, it is better to go for a thermal carafe with double-wall insulated carafes.

Types Of Automatic Pour-Over Coffee Makers

Pour-over coffee makers typically are very similar in terms of their functioning. However, the major factor on which some types can be differentiated is the material used for making the machine.

1. Ceramic

Ceramic automatic pour-over coffee makers are made of chemically inert ceramic that does not cause any taste difference. The material is thick, sturdy, and more durable than glass. It is also a better insulator than glass, so it would keep your coffee hot for longer.

2. Glass

Glass, like ceramic, is also chemically inert and thus suitable for the job. Glass is aesthetic-looking as well. To maintain optimal temperature, however, you would need to preheat the glass, and it is a lot less durable than ceramic.

3. Metal

In particular, copper metal is a lightweight and durable material for a coffee maker, but it does not retain heat efficiently. Since the coffee grounds will quickly lose their heat, extraction may not be effective in a metallic automatic pour-over coffee maker.

4. Plastic

Plastic is another excellent alternative that is both lightweight and durable. It makes for a good portable coffee maker, and the material is able to retain heat well in the brew bed.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q1. Is pour-over coffee better or drip coffee?

In general, pour-over coffee has a better taste than drip coffee. It has a much more vibrant flavor than drip coffee, although it takes much longer to make.

Q2. How does the flavor of a pour-over coffee from an automatic pour-over coffee maker differ from that of a manually brewed pour-over coffee?

If there is any difference at all, it is certainly in favor of the coffee because of the difference in the way the water is poured over the grounds. The water is sprayed evenly over the grounds via the shower distributor, allowing better extraction.

Q3. How should I adjust the cup size of the machine if it has no selector?

The water reservoir has a fill line indicating the level of water needed. If your machine does not have a selector, simply fill the reservoir with less water if you have a cup smaller than the maximum cup size.

Q4, How will I be able to tell how much coffee grounds one mug would need?

Most of the machines in the market have a fill line for the level of grounds indicating how much needs to be added. If this is not the case, you would have to try out the various amounts to decide what the ideal quantity is for you.

Q5. Are automatic pour-over coffee makers hard to operate?

Understanding an automatic pour-over coffee maker is certainly not a tricky thing to do. On the contrary, they are pretty easy to understand, customize, and program if you read the manual thoroughly.

Q6. How does pour-over brewing of coffee differ from drip brewing?

In both types, hot water is passed through grounds placed in a filter. The difference exists in the brewing time, flow rate, taste, aroma, and quality of the coffee. Since pour-over coffee involves greater precision, it often tastes better.

Q7. What coffee beans are the best for automatic pour-over coffee?

Although it is entirely dependent on your personal preference what kind of coffee beans you like, I prefer medium roasted beans for pour-over coffee as it gives a bright and smooth flavor.

Q8. What grinds are best for pour-over coffee from an automatic coffee maker?

Flat and cone bottomed coffee makers make the best use of medium-coarse coffee grounds. The grind size should be increased when using Chemex paper filters.

Q9. How is pour-over coffee a healthier alternative?

Pour-over coffee is healthier for the heart as the heat-harming cholesterol from the coffee beans is filtered out, and the risk of cardiovascular disease is reduced significantly.

Q10. Is pour-over coffee a better choice than the French press?

For users who love smooth coffee, pour-over is definitely better than the French press. A pour-over coffee machine is also easier to clean up after as no dismantling is needed.
